With the arrival of autumn, it becomes essential to conduct a thorough review of homes to ensure their protection against the harshness of the weather. It is crucial to analyze the condition of the roof, foundation, windows, and plumbing, as leaks, flooding, or detachment may worsen with storms and frost.
Climate change has increased the frequency and severity of weather phenomena that threaten the safety of our homes. A recent study reveals that 44% of home insurance claims are due to water damage, underscoring the importance of proper prevention.

Among the most damaging phenomena are frost and hailstorms. Frost particularly affects roofs and exposed areas. Understanding the frost resistance of construction materials is crucial, as it determines their resilience to freezing temperatures. The freezing of water in these materials can lead to cracks that, during thawing, allow moisture to enter.
During storms, adequate insulation in homes becomes essential. Sealing doors and windows, as well as keeping blinds down, are some of the recommended measures. Additionally, it is vital to keep gutters and downspouts clean to avoid blockages that can lead to dampness.
